Northern MN Lakeside Home
Northern MN Lakeside Home
Lenox House DesignLenox House Design
This lower level bar was a special surprise from wife to husband - the custom Criss Craft boat island was kept under wraps until unveiled in a special moment. The floor is a wide plank floor that mimics wood but with fun blue and grey color tones. The backsplash tile is an oversides arabesque mosaic in a blue that miimics the lake water. The bar is truly a kitchenette for entertaining on the lake level, complete with full fridge, range, dishwasher and built in bar on that far left cabinet. The counterstools were custom made for the project by a local craftsman.
Transitional Kitchen Remodel in Naples, FL
Transitional Kitchen Remodel in Naples, FL
Progressive Design BuildProgressive Design Build
The result of this thoughtful remodel is a beautifully transformed living space that now effortlessly combines functionality with aesthetic charm. The relocation of the eating area and kitchen created a more functional layout, offering a significant increase in countertop space, a carefully placed cooktop hood vented to the outside, and a spacious island. Double ovens and a separate microwave were added to enhance the culinary experience. The removal of a non-structural stairwell wall brought a refreshing open feel to the area, and a reconfigured entrance to the bedroom zone allowed for a seamless kitchen wall that maximizes cabinet storage. High-quality cabinets, including an innovative walk-in pantry design, and a delightful Jeffrey Court marble mosaic behind the cooktop added a touch of elegance. Moreover, a specially designated space was artfully created to display the homeowner’s cherished collection of anniversary plates, forming a unique and personal touch in this refreshed home.
Major Renovation with Universal Design Elements
Major Renovation with Universal Design Elements
Irons Brothers Construction IncIrons Brothers Construction Inc
We remodeled this unassuming mid-century home from top to bottom. An entire third floor and two outdoor decks were added. As a bonus, we made the whole thing accessible with an elevator linking all three floors. The 3rd floor was designed to be built entirely above the existing roof level to preserve the vaulted ceilings in the main level living areas. Floor joists spanned the full width of the house to transfer new loads onto the existing foundation as much as possible. This minimized structural work required inside the existing footprint of the home. A portion of the new roof extends over the custom outdoor kitchen and deck on the north end, allowing year-round use of this space. Exterior finishes feature a combination of smooth painted horizontal panels, and pre-finished fiber-cement siding, that replicate a natural stained wood. Exposed beams and cedar soffits provide wooden accents around the exterior. Horizontal cable railings were used around the rooftop decks. Natural stone installed around the front entry enhances the porch. Metal roofing in natural forest green, tie the whole project together. On the main floor, the kitchen remodel included minimal footprint changes, but overhauling of the cabinets and function. A larger window brings in natural light, capturing views of the garden and new porch. The sleek kitchen now shines with two-toned cabinetry in stained maple and high-gloss white, white quartz countertops with hints of gold and purple, and a raised bubble-glass chiseled edge cocktail bar. The kitchen’s eye-catching mixed-metal backsplash is a fun update on a traditional penny tile. The dining room was revamped with new built-in lighted cabinetry, luxury vinyl flooring, and a contemporary-style chandelier. Throughout the main floor, the original hardwood flooring was refinished with dark stain, and the fireplace revamped in gray and with a copper-tile hearth and new insert. During demolition our team uncovered a hidden ceiling beam. The clients loved the look, so to meet the planned budget, the beam was turned into an architectural feature, wrapping it in wood paneling matching the entry hall. The entire day-light basement was also remodeled, and now includes a bright & colorful exercise studio and a larger laundry room. The redesign of the washroom includes a larger showering area built specifically for washing their large dog, as well as added storage and countertop space.
